Green marble rock?

Green marble rock is a type of metamorphic rock that is characterized by its green color due to the presence of minerals like serpentine, chlorite, or epidote. It is commonly used in construction and decorative applications such as countertops, flooring, and sculptures due to its unique and visually appealing appearance. Green marble is known for its durability, but may require periodic maintenance to preserve its luster and color.

Can granite become marble?

No, granite cannot become marble. Granite and marble are two distinct types of rocks formed under different geological conditions. Granite is an igneous rock formed from the cooling of molten rock, while marble is a metamorphic rock formed from the recrystallization of limestone.


What is the main mineral marble is made up of?

Marble is primarily composed of the mineral calcite, which is a form of calcium carbonate. Other minerals found in marble can include dolomite, serpentine, and various other impurities that give marble its characteristic color and veining.

What is the name of the large marble in a game of marbles?

it's called a godfather - sorry it's not called this - see the following Various names refer to the marbles' size. Any marble larger than the majority may be termed a boulder, masher, popper, shooter, taw, bumbo, bumboozer, bowler, tonk, tronk, godfather, tom bowler, giant. A marble smaller than the majority is a peawee or mini. A grandfather is the largest marble, the size of a pool table ball or tennis ball.
